#6eb8d2 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#6eb8d2 is composed of 43.1% red, 72.2% green and 82.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 47.6% cyan, 12.4% magenta, 0% yellow and 17.6% black. It has a hue angle of 195.6 degrees, a saturation of 52.6% and a lightness of 62.7%. #6eb8d2 color hex could be obtained by blending #dcffff with #0071a5. Closest websafe color is: #66cccc.

Shades and Tints of #6eb8d2

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010405 is the darkest color, while #f5fafc is the lightest one.

Tones of #6eb8d2

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#9aa3a6 is the less saturated color, while #42cdfe is the most saturated one.
